The Allure of Unique Handmade FurnitureUnique handmade furniture varies noticeably from mass-produced pieces. Each product typically reflects the craftsmen's style, imagination, and commitment to their craft. Handmade pieces can vary in style, materials, and strategies utilized, which contributes to their individuality. Let's delve deeper into what makes these pieces attractive.

  1. Individuality and Character
    Every handcrafted product is distinctive, providing distinctive features that are not possible in factory-made furniture. This individuality often comes through in:

Materials: Artisans often utilize locally sourced, sustainable materials that highlight the character of the wood or other parts.

Design: Typically, furniture designers will incorporate their unique vision, leading to shapes, colors, and textures that challenge contemporary standards.

Craftsmen Techniques: Various methods such as joinery, inlay, or woodturning can even more accentuate the originality of each piece.

  1. Quality and Durability
    Unlike machine-made furniture, which may prioritize cost-saving and consistent products, unique handmade furniture highlights quality. Craftsmens typically take great pride in picking premium woods and crafting approaches that ensure durability. The advantages of buying durable handmade pieces include:

Sustainability: Handmade furniture tends to be more sustainable, as it often uses recovered or properly sourced materials.

Long-lasting Value: A well-kept handmade piece can often become a heirloom, offering considerable value in time.

Superior Craftsmanship: Attention to information and individualized finishing touches often see handmade products outperform their mass-produced equivalents.

  1. Supporting Local Artisans
    Buying unique handmade furniture not just enhances individual home but likewise supports local craftsmens and economies. This is useful because:

Local Economies: Buying from local craftsmen keeps cash within neighborhoods and contributes to task creation.

Cultural Preservation: Many craftsmens possess abilities passed down through generations, helping to protect traditional craftsmanship methods.

Custom Service: Working directly with artisans frequently results in customized service and the chance for custom designs fit to specific requirements and preferences.

FAQ About Unique Handmade Furniture

Q: How can I find unique handmade furniture?
A: Potential purchasers can discover artisanal furniture through local craftsmens, craft fairs, specialty shops, online markets like Etsy, or social media platforms showcasing innovative work.

Q: Is handmade furniture more costly than mass-produced items?
A: While handmade furniture can be more expensive due to the labor and products involved, it's crucial to consider the quality, toughness, and unique qualities that could validate the investment.

Q: How do I care for my handmade furniture?
A: Proper upkeep typically includes dusting routinely, using suitable cleansing products for the material, and preventing extended exposure to sunlight or wetness to protect the stability of the piece.

Q: Can I request custom designs from craftsmens?
A: Yes, numerous craftsmens are open to custom requests. It is recommended to discuss your ideas and requirements straight with them to explore what is possible.

Q: Why should I pick handmade over mass-produced?
A: Choosing handmade typically shows a dedication to uniqueness, quality, sustainability, and support for the craft neighborhood, delivering pieces that not just serve functionally however also bring stories and emotions.
